George recently graduated from college with a Master's Degree in Basket Weaving. During the few months he spends searching for a stable basket weaving job, he is experiencing:
A
Structural unemployment
B
Frictional unemployment
C
Natural Unemployment
D
Cyclical Unemployment

Understand the different types of unemployment: Frictional, Structural, Cyclical, and Natural Unemployment.
Frictional Unemployment occurs when individuals are temporarily between jobs or are searching for new jobs that better match their skills.
Structural Unemployment arises from a mismatch between the skills workers possess and the skills needed by employers, often due to technological changes or shifts in the economy.
Cyclical Unemployment is related to the business cycle, where unemployment rises during economic downturns and falls when the economy improves.
Natural Unemployment is the sum of frictional and structural unemployment, representing the unemployment rate when the economy is at full employment.
